Wales visit Wembley tonight to take on England in a friendly before both teams’ Nations League campaigns resume at the weekend.

The friendly, a warm-up for England’s meetings with Belgium on Sunday and Denmark on Wednesday, and Wales’ games against the Republic of Ireland and Bulgaria on the same dates, marks the first match between the nations since Euro 2016.

At that competition in France, England were 2-1 winners in the group stage, several months before Gareth Southgate was named Three Lions manager.

What is the team news?

Jadon Sancho, Tammy Abraham and Ben Chilwell will miss the match, having broken coronavirus guidelines. Mason Greenwood and Phil Foden have also been left out after similarly breaking Covid-19 rules last month. Manchester United captain Harry Maguire has been recalled.

Dominic Calvert-Lewin and Bukayo Saka make their first England senior appearances while Jack Grealish makes his first start. 

Gareth Bale has been left out of Ryan Giggs’ Wales squad due to a lack of fitness, and Aaron Ramsey had had to withdraw due to Juventus’ coronavirus guidelines.
